I went out with Joe in that boat on Thursday for one last test before it shipped down to Hideaway. That boat does not need a windshield, and it has an LCD that shows the speed digitally, so when the 100 mph speedo isn't enough (I don't think even Wayne thought these would be that fast) you can still tell just how fast you are going.

Going 60 in one of those boats is like going 60 in a Lincoln or a Caddy on the freeway. Going 80 is like doing 80 in your Lincoln or Caddy with the windows down. Going 95 or so is the same, only your sunglasses try to pull off your face. So you had better get goggles.

As far as the wind, doing 50 in a Ranger bass boat is much, much worse. You really don't get that "My skin is going to blow off my face" feeling in the cockpit of the F-4.

Someone needs to order one of these with 850's or 1075's so we can see one really cook!

Honestly, doing 90 in an F-4 is less eventfull than 40 in my Nova. That boat is that good!
